Measurements of tube wall thickness were made with an ultrasonic measuring device , after removal of deposits and slag ... The reduction in wall thickness in the furnace , screen and superheater tubes is in the range of 16 % to 45 % .

Glassy slag This deposit accumulates on the left side of the superheater tubes , forming wavy bodies , adhering to the tube , similar to stalactites , but growing sidewise in the direction of the flame flow .
